How To Play

Pick 5 numbers out of 39. Then pick your Hot Ball, 1 out of 19.

Pick your own numbers or let the computer pick them for you by asking for an easy pick.

Purchase up to 10 consecutive drawings at a time.

Drawings held at 9:40 p.m. Wednesdays and Saturdays. Sales cut-off time is 8:18 pm on the day of the drawing.

Win the jackpot by matching all 5 white numbers and the Hot Ball. Other prizes also awarded.

Hot Lotto prizes must be claimed within 365 days of the drawing for which they were eligible.

Hot Lotto Sizzler Option

Ask your retailer for the Hot Lotto Sizzler option every time you play Hot Lotto and you will triple your prize (except the jackpot).

Pay $1 extra per play and your prize, except for the jackpot, will be multiplied by three. A $500 prize would be worth $1,500 and a $10,000 prize would be worth $30,000! The Hot Lotto Sizzler is a permanent addition to the Hot Lotto game.

Prizes & Odds

Jackpot starts at $1 million!

Match Prize Without
Hot Lotto Sizzler
Prize With
Hot Lotto Sizzler
Odds
5 + 1 *Jackpot *Jackpot 1 in 10,939,383.00
5 + 0 $10,000 $30,000 1 in 607,744.00
4 + 1 $500 $1,500 1 in 689,064.85
4 + 0 $50 $150 1 in 15,312.55
3 + 1 $50 $150 1 in 1,950.00
3 + 0 $4 $12 1 in 108.00
2 + 1 $4 $12 1 in 183.00
1 + 1 $3 $9 1 in 47.00
0 + 1 $2 $6 1 in 39.00

Overall Odds: 1 in 16.09

* The jackpot prize will be divided equally among multiple winners based on the amount available to the lottery for the jackpot prize pool. The set prize amounts published here are based on the expected number of winners shared in the prize pool. In some cases, these prizes may be paid on a pari-mutuel basis and will be lower than these prize levels.

Participating Lotteries

Delaware, Idaho, Iowa, Kansas, Maine, Minnesota, Montana, New Hampshire, New Mexico, North Dakota, Oklahoma, South Dakota, Vermont, West Virginia and District of Columbia.

A Note About Jackpots

You have 60 days to decide whether to collect a jackpot prize with the annuity or cash option. If you select the annuity option and the cost to purchase the annuity is less than $250,000, the lottery may elect to pay that prize as a cash option prize. If you select the cash option, the prize will be a single cash payment equal to the amount available to the lottery for the jackpot prize pool. The cash prize is estimated to be approximately one-half of the estimated annuitized jackpot (the advertised jackpot paid over 25 years), depending on current interest rates.
